    these are itshay because they suck in all the cooled air and throw it outside with the hot air

    • +3

      Not sure why you're getting negged as this has been proven time and time again. Only those which have two hoses (one to bring in outside air and then the other to expel it) actually cool the air in the room.

      Keep your home comfortable with the Carson PA200 Portable Air Conditioner. Just sit back, relax, and use the remote control to adjust the temperature from the comfort of your lounge. This compact unit is ideal for cooling rooms of up to 15 square metres.

      Thanks to the 360° swivel caster wheels you can effortlessly place the unit wherever it's needed most. The easily installable, adjustable window exhaust kit simplifies the removal of warm air to make those long hot Summers a breeze!

      The PA200 offers more than just air conditioning; it also includes a dehumidifier mode to reduce the level of moisture in the air, making it ideal for humid or damp environments. Thanks to its integrated self-evaporation system, you can set it and forget it, as it efficiently eliminates the need for constant water emptying, ensuring a hassle-free experience.

      Set the timer on the user-friendly LCD display up to 24 hours in advance, ensuring you come home to the perfect temperature everytime.

      Sleek portable design
      Ideal for rooms of up to 15 square metres
      Easy to read LCD display
      Remote control included
      Dehumidifier and fan modes
      Self-evaporating system
      24 hour timer
      Easy to install window exhaust kit

      Specifications:
      Brand: Carson
      Model: PA200
      Cooling Capacity: 2.05kW (7000BTU)
      Noise level: 65dB
      Refrigerant: R290
      Airflow Volume: 300m³/h
      Recommended Room Size: 12-15m2
      Input voltage: 240V 50Hz
      Power Plug: Australian Standard (10A)
      Note: The frequency of emptying water is dependent on the level of humidity in the air and also the mode the unit is operating in e.g. the dehumidify function will require more frequent emptying.
